深入解析 V2Ray 的 mkcp:应用与配置教程

引言

在现代互联网的环境中,隐私和访问速度成为了人们高度关注的问题。V2Ray 作为一款强大的网络代理工具,通过各种协议来达到加速和隐匿网络流量的目的。其中,mkcp 协议作为 V2Ray 的一种无线传输方式,受到了越来越多用户的青睐。

什么是 mkcp 协议

mkcp 是基于 KCP(”凿路”协议)构建的传输协议。KCP 协议通过一系列的优先级和派遣机制在減少数据包的丟失率以及延时方面表现出色,适合于复杂的网络环境。V2Ray 中的 mkcp 结合了 KCP 协议的高效传输和特定的加密机制,极大地提高了用户的网络体验。

mkcp 的工作原理

在探讨如何配置 mkcp 之前,首先需要了解它的工作原理:

  • 数据包的分段传输mkcp 对数据进行分段处理,能够有效降低数据包丢失的影响。
  • 并发连接:使用多个连接同时传输数据,提高传输速率和稳定性。
  • 混淆功能:在基础传输上可选用某种混淆,隐藏流量特点,增强网络安全。

V2Ray mkcp 应用场景

下列为 mkcp 在 V2Ray 中应用的一些常见场景:

  • 游戏加速:具体体现在对延迟敏感的快节奏在线游戏中。
  • 视频流媒体播放:如观看在线视频时,确保流畅度。
  • 匿名上网:保护用户的隐私及防止监视。

如何配置 V2Ray mkcp

步骤 1:下载和安装 V2Ray

  1. 前往 V2Ray 官方网站 下载最新版 V2Ray。
  2. 根据操作系统选择相应的安装包,完成安装。

步骤 2:配置 mkcp 服务

  1. 打开配置文件 config.json

  2. 找到 "outbounds" 部分,您可以看到几种协议的配置项。找到您想要使用的出站连接并初始化配置:

    {
    “protocol”: “mkcp”,
    “settings”: {
    “mtu”: 1350,
    “tti”: 20,
    “uplinkCapacity”: 16,
    “downlinkCapacity”: 100,
    “congestion”: false,
    “readBufferSize”: 1,
    “writeBufferSize”: 1,
    “header”: {
    “type”: “wechat-video”
    }
    }
    },

  3. 调整参数建议根据网络情况,完成配置。

步骤 3:启动 V2Ray

使用命令行或对应的桌面程序启动 V2Ray,即可进入 mkcp 的工作模式。

mkcp 的优势与劣势

优势

  • 低延迟、高速:在某些网络条件下,相比传统的 TCP,可以有效减少数据包少,同时确保网络延迟较低。
  • 适应性强mkcp 能在丢包严重的网络中保持较好的连接稳定性和速度。
  • 混淆小流量特征:隐藏在小数据包中进行传输,不易被检测。

劣势

  • *流量消耗:由于其采用了多重连接,可能在高流量情况下会增加运算压力。
  • 复杂配置:相较于其他协议,配置过程较复杂,需要一定的网络基础。

V2Ray mkcp 常见问题 FAQ

mkcp 使用有什么注意事项吗?

  • 确保您的 Internet 环境是良好的,频繁的丢包和高延迟将影响使用体验。
  • 优化 mtu 的设置,找到最匹配您当前网络的参数。

mkcp 协议比南华的 TCP 协议有优势吗?

  • 在网络的传输速率和稳定性相对较好,尤其是在不利环境下,mkcp 的优势会更加明显。

使用 mkcp 是否增加了延迟?

  • 一般情况下,mkcp 会测试不同算法以保持更低的延迟,但具体体验将根据当前网络状况不同而有所不同。

###怎洁一定配置,无需更改代理设置?

  • 可以通过 URL 打开应用程序设置,不需要专项编译或调试发包内容。

结语

V2Ray 的 mkcp 协议为用户提供了一种快速且相对安全的网络体验。 在适当的配合下,它可以在纷严的非法网络中继续保持良好的可访问性和相对有秩序的数据流动。希望本篇文章能帮助你更好地配置和使用 V2Ray 的 mkcp ,享受更加流畅和安全的网络体验。

正文完
 0